Milwaukee County, WI vs Monmouth County, NJ

Property Tax Rate Comparison 2025

Quick Answer

Milwaukee County, WI: 1.35% effective rate · $4,194/yr median tax · median home $310,670

Monmouth County, NJ: 2.07% effective rate · $10,353/yr median tax · median home $500,190

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the property tax difference between Milwaukee County and Monmouth County?
Milwaukee County, WI has an effective property tax rate of 1.35% with a median annual tax of $4,194. Monmouth County, NJ has a rate of 2.07% with a median annual tax of $10,353. The difference is 0.72 percentage points.
Which county has higher property taxes, Milwaukee County or Monmouth County?
Monmouth County, NJ has the higher effective property tax rate at 2.07% compared to 1.35%.
How do Milwaukee County and Monmouth County compare to the national average?
The national average effective property tax rate is 1.06%. Milwaukee County is above average at 1.35%, and Monmouth County is above average at 2.07%.
